> while dropping a view which does not really exist on a database , the error 
> message thrown by ij says ERROR X0X05: Table 'VIEW222' does not  exist. It 
> looks like we should make the error message to say that  "Table/View" does 
> not exist, instead of "table".
> Look at other messages that are shared for both Table and View.
